Output 3c29497c54dc762089d5a6bd78a63a52936de8b17dbe5bf60a087ae81aef3615:0

value
389862
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dadf58bff52287cbab5aeb01f6d318760aa8cded2c4ef95a5acd341fa2ad73b1
address
bc1pmt0430l4y2ruh266avqld5ccwc923n0d9380jkj6e56plg4dwwcsm5z64g
transaction
3c29497c54dc762089d5a6bd78a63a52936de8b17dbe5bf60a087ae81aef3615
spent
true